Abstract
The development of digital health services in Indonesia continues to increase. However, the need for patient assistance to hospitals has not been widely accommodated, especially for patients who cannot always be accompanied by their families. This study aims to design the UI/UX of the Dampingin mobile application as a service for finding hospital companion assistance using the User Centered Design method. Data collection was conducted through questionnaires involving 30 respondents and interviews with 20 respondents consisting of patients’ relatives, patients, caregivers, and hospital staff. The results of user needs were then processed into empathy maps, affinity diagrams, user personas, information architecture, user flows, wireframes, design systems, and high-fidelity prototypes. The design evaluation was carried out through usability testing using Maze, system usability scale, and heuristic evaluation. The testing results showed improvements after design revisions were made. On the patient side, the average SUS score increased from 88 to 89, which falls into the “Excellent” category with a grade B rating. On the caregiver side, the average SUS score increased from 83.5 to 92, which falls into the “Excellent” category with a grade A rating. The final results for both user groups indicate an Acceptable level of usability. These results indicate that the Dampingin application design is acceptable to users, easy to use, and provides a positive user experience.
